Location: Bristol
The Best Connection is a leading employee-owned temporary recruitment agency, supporting a wide range of sectors. With over 30 years of experience and more than 80 branches nationwide, we are one of the UK’s largest recruitment businesses, specialising primarily in the driving and industrial sectors.
We’re looking for a driven and energetic individual to join our team. Whether you’re new to recruitment or looking to take the next step in your career, we want to hear from you! We offer full on-the-job training, support, and guidance to help you succeed, no matter your experience level.
Salary & Package:
Entry Level Consultant (No Experience)
- Basic Salary: £26,000, increasing to £27,000 after 12 months
- First-Year Earning Potential: £28,000–£29,000 with commission
Experienced Recruitment Consultant
- Basic Salary: £27,000 – £29,000
- OTE: £30,000 – £33,000 with commission
Senior Recruitment Consultant
- Basic Salary: £31,500
- OTE: £35,000 – £37,000 with commission
- Company car / car allowance (£400 per month)
About the Role:
- Manage the full 360 recruitment cycle, from business development to candidate placement
- Build and maintain long‑term relationships with clients and candidates
- Proactively identify and win new clients through sales calls and face‑to‑face visits
- Source, interview, and match candidates to roles while maintaining high levels of compliance and quality
- Work towards achievable sales and performance goals with full support and training
What’s on Offer:
✅ 30 days annual leave (including bank holidays) rising to 33 days after one year
✅ Dedicated in‑house training department offering industry‑leading training and mentorship
✅ Recruitment Consultants will complete a Level 3 Recruiter Qualification as a key part of the development in this role
✅ Senior Consultants also get the opportunity to gain a Level 3 Certificate in Principles of Recruitment
✅ Structured career progression & development opportunities
✅ Competitive, uncapped commission structure
✅ Be part of an employee‑owned business and benefit from the opportunity for tax‑free annual bonuses
✅ Company pension scheme & cycle to work scheme
✅ Lifestyle benefits – Discounts on hotels, insurance, energy bills, and more
Branch Bonuses
- Free Car Parking
- Warm Established Desk
Hours of Work
Monday to Friday 8:00AM – 5:00PM (1 hour lunch break)
Office Based Role
For this role a full current driving licence is required.

How to prepare for a job interview at The Best Connection Group Ltd
✨Know the Company Inside Out
Before your interview, take some time to research The Best Connection. Understand their values, the sectors they operate in, and their approach to recruitment. This will not only help you answer questions more effectively but also show your genuine interest in the role.
✨Prepare for the 360 Recruitment Cycle
Since the role involves managing the full recruitment cycle, think about how you would approach each stage. Be ready to discuss strategies for business development, candidate sourcing, and client relationship management. Having specific examples or ideas in mind will impress your interviewers.
✨Show Your Sales Skills
As a Recruitment Consultant, sales skills are crucial. Prepare to talk about any past experiences where you've successfully sold an idea or product, even if it’s not directly related to recruitment. Highlight your ability to build relationships and persuade others, as this is key in winning new clients.
✨Ask Thoughtful Questions
At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ions! Inquire about the training process, career progression opportunities, or the company culture. This shows that you’re not just interested in the job, but also in how you can grow within the company.
